URMYWO Baby Loungers Recalled Due to Risk of Serious Injury or Death from Suffoc...
Reason for Recall / Hazard
The baby loungers violate the mandatory standard for Infant Sleep Products because the sides are shorter than the minimum side height limit to secure the infant; the sleeping pad's thickness exceeds the maximum limit, posing a suffocation hazard; and an infant could fall out of an enclosed opening at the foot of the lounger or become entrapped. The portable loungers do not have a stand, posing a fall hazard. These violations create an unsafe sleeping environment for infants, posing a risk of serious injury or death.
Product Description & Identification
This recall involves URMYWO baby loungers in the style "grey feather." The baby loungers are made of a gray cloth cover printed with feathers with a foam sleeping pad and padded bumpers. "URMYWO" and "Model No: UMCZC01AE" are printed on labels located on the side of the lounger.

| Injuries › Name | None reported |
| Products › Name | URMYWO Baby Loungers |
| Products › Number Of Units | About 23,000 |
| Recall I D | 10397 |
| Remedies › Name | Consumers should stop using the baby loungers immediately and contact Pomona for a full refund. Consumers should remove the sleeping pad, cut up the sides of the baby loungers and the sleeping pad and email a photo of the destroyed lounger to urmyworecall@outlook.com to obtain a full refund. |
| Retailers › Name | Amazon from January 2024 through April 2025 for between $30 and $50. |
